Phraatakes, 2BC - 4 AD
|
BI tdr., 12.31gr; 26,74mm; Sellw. 56.2 or 4, Shore 312/13, Sunrise -;
mint: Seleukia; axis: 12h;
obv.: bare-headed, left, w/4-strand diadem and 3 ribbons; medium-long hair in 3 waves, temple lock, mustache, med.-long tapered beard; segmented necklace; tunic/cuirass w/ornamental border;
rev.: king, right, on throne, facing goddess, left, w/diadem in outstretched right hand and conucopia in left arm; between the heads the year IT (= 2/3 AD); exergual line; 6 lines of legend visible: BΛCIΛC(ΩC) BΛCIΛCΩ(N) (ΛPCΛKOY) CYCIΓCT(OY) ΔIKAIOV (to be read from the inside), month off flan, (C)ΠIΦΛNOVC (ΦI)ΛCΛΛHNO(C);
ex: Baldwin’s Auction 96 (09/15), multiple coin lot (ex David Sellwood Collection).
